Concrete foundation leveling services involve the process of restoring a property’s foundation to a more stable and even position. This typically includes identifying areas where the concrete has shifted, settled, or become uneven over time, then applying specialized techniques to lift and level the surface. The work often utilizes equipment such as hydraulic jacks and polyurethane foam to carefully raise sunken sections of the foundation or concrete slabs, ensuring the structure maintains proper alignment and support. The goal is to address issues caused by ground movement or soil conditions that lead to uneven surfaces and compromised stability.

Professionals offering foundation leveling services utilize various methods tailored to the specific needs of each property. These can include polyurethane foam jacking, mudjacking, or slab lifting, depending on the extent of the settlement and the type of foundation. The process generally involves assessing the condition of the concrete, preparing the area, and then carefully applying the chosen method to lift and stabilize the surface. Concrete foundation leveling services are often sought by property owners in Mount Clemens, MI when signs of settling or unevenness appear in their homes or commercial buildings. Common situations include c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that no longer close properly, or visible shifts in the structure’s level. These issues can develop over time due to soil movement, moisture changes, or natural settling, prompting owners to look for professional solutions to restore stability and safety.
